Melissa Lipska is a seasoned professional with extensive experience in parks and forestry management, currently serving as the Parks and Forestry Operations Manager for the City of Waukesha since May 2015, overseeing more than 1,200 acres of park and open space with a dedicated team of over 45 staff members. Previously, Melissa worked as the Buildings & Facilities Maintenance Supervisor for the City of West Bend from October 2008 to May 2015, and as a Landscape Architect at Q. Grady Minor & Associates, P.A. from June 2007 to October 2008. Additional foundational experience includes a role as a Landscape Architectural Intern at the University of Wisconsin-Madison from April 2004 to May 2007 and work as a Laboratory Associate in the Plant Pathology Department, focusing on media preparation and plant RNA and DNA extraction. Melissa holds a Bachelor of Science degree in Landscape Architecture from the University of Wisconsin-Madison, earned in 2007.
